浏览代码

openjdk needs ant for now

Waldemar Brodkorb 14 年之前
父节点
当前提交
3acc20917b
共有 1 个文件被更改,包括 11 次插入0 次删除
  1. 11 0
      scripts/scan-pkgs.sh

+ 11 - 0
scripts/scan-pkgs.sh

@@ -79,6 +79,10 @@ if [[ -n $ADK_COMPILE_KRB5 ]]; then
 	NEED_BISON="$NEED_BISON krb5"
 fi
 
+if [[ -n $ADK_COMPILE_OPENJDK ]]; then
+	NEED_ANT="$NEED_ANT openjdk"
+fi
+
 if [[ -n $ADK_PACKAGE_LIBXCB ]]; then
 	NEED_XSLTPROC="$NEED_XSLTPROC libxcb"
 fi
@@ -333,6 +337,13 @@ if [[ -n $NEED_FLEX ]]; then
 	fi
 fi
 
+if [[ -n $NEED_ANT ]]; then
+	if ! which ant >/dev/null 2>&1; then
+		echo >&2 You need ant to build $NEED_OPENJDK
+		out=1
+	fi
+fi
+
 if [[ -n $NEED_YASM ]]; then
 	if ! which yasm >/dev/null 2>&1; then
 		echo >&2 You need yasm to build $NEED_YASM